Got the head on and torqued it down. Then the camshafts. We used the same camshaft caps that was with the head. You should never mix and match old cam caps. Then we degreed in the cams. I learned how to set the degree tool and the math on how figure it out.
In between all this Jeff put on the Vance and Hines clutch hub (which was even balanced) while I was on a wild goose chase looking for 7mm allen bolts for the camshaft sprockets. When I came back empty handed and a complete failure he found his and already had the exhaust cam installed.
While we were degreeing the cams I guess the signal generator lost a wire right at the unit. "No problem" says Jeff and pulls one out a of a rats nest of electrical units. So he put on the valve cover and stator cover while I wired in the new signal generator.
